Output 0026f63eccfdbb99788571fb71f7e9b5a71cdfd842009dc51f02e2181bb49b85:0

value
139524
script pubkey
OP_0 OP_PUSHBYTES_20 dd805e95450ebe29468fc9f93ff2d2a2f21b36ad
address
bc1qmkq9a929p6lzj350e8unlukj5tepkd4d9rp6e9
transaction
0026f63eccfdbb99788571fb71f7e9b5a71cdfd842009dc51f02e2181bb49b85
spent
true